How to Implement obo Hooda Math Techniques in Your Learning

Integrating obo Hooda math strategies into your study routine can significantly enhance your mathematical abilities. Here are some actionable tips to help you get started.

Start With Understanding the Problem

Before jumping into calculations, take time to read and comprehend the problem fully. Ask yourself what is being asked, what data is provided, and what the final goal is. This reflection aligns with the obo Hooda emphasis on logical analysis.

Break Problems Into Smaller Steps

Large problems can be overwhelming. Divide them into smaller parts and solve each one systematically. This technique not only simplifies the process but also helps avoid mistakes.

Use Visual Aids and Diagrams

Drawing diagrams or charts can provide visual clarity. Whether it's geometry, algebra, or word problems, visual representation often aids understanding and uncovers hidden relationships.

Practice Regularly With Diverse Problems

Diversity in practice questions trains your brain to adapt and apply concepts flexibly. Include puzzles, brain teasers, and real-world math applications to keep your practice sessions engaging.

Discuss and Collaborate With Peers

Learning with others can expose you to different problem-solving approaches. Group discussions often lead to deeper insights and reinforce your understanding.

Mathematical Traditions in Regional Contexts

India has a rich tradition of mathematics dating back millennia, with significant contributions from scholars such as Aryabhata, Brahmagupta, and Bhaskara. Regional centers of learning, often associated with religious or monastic institutions, played critical roles in preserving and advancing mathematical knowledge.
